Graymont is seeking a Finance Business Partner, NA (Central Region). Reporting to the Director, Financial Analysis and Operations Support, NA, the Finance Business Partner will support plant operations in the Central region regarding financial reporting, analysis, budgeting, forecasting, and other support including capital projects and compliance. The Finance Business Partner will be the main contact for finance-related matters for sales and operations teams.
Responsibilities
Review plant operation results proactively, conduct meetings with Plant Managers to discuss performance, analyze variances, and collaborate with departments to resolve issues.
Assist in preparing budgets, multi-year plans, and forecasts.
Support analysis of capital and strategic projects, review proposals, and assist with post-audit reviews.
Conduct financial assessments such as pricing adjustments and product profitability analysis.
Oversee accounting controls, review data accuracy, ensure policy compliance, and assist with purchasing and accounts payable processes.
Support external audits and liaise between operations and accounting.
Support property management, leases, permits, and compliance with regulations.
Qualifications
Bachelor’s or associate deg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field.
4 to 7 years of experience in cost and management accounting.
Professional accounting designation is an asset.
Familiarity with ERP and Business Intelligence solutions (JD Edwards, Cognos).
Ability to interpret financial results and experience with NPV and IRR analysis.
Demonstrated ability to drive value creation and collaborate with sales and operations teams.
Willingness to travel within North America (~25%).
Excellent communication skills; bilingual in French is an asset.
